Sustainability is increasingly becoming a critical metric for technology companies, and the pc all industry is taking significant steps toward reducing its environmental impact. Green PC manufacturing involves adopting energy‑efficient production techniques, using recycled and biodegradable materials, and designing for longevity and repairability. These initiatives address the challenges of electronic waste (e‑waste) and contribute to a circular economy where components are reused or recycled rather than discarded.

Enhanced GPU Virtualization:
With the advent of virtual GPU (vGPU) technology, high‑performance applications—including 3D rendering, CAD, and gaming—can run on virtual desktops without sacrificing performance.

Standardized Interfaces:
The increasing adoption of universal connectors (PCI‑Express 5.0, USB‑C, Thunderbolt) ensures compatibility across different product generations, facilitating easy upgrades.
